For the board of Quillon Instruments: our search for a second-source supplier of the Veryl sensor module has narrowed to two candidates, Ostrand Fabrication in Delmere and Karrowtech of Port Ilsen. Both passed initial quality audits; Ostrand offers shorter lead times, while Karrowtech quotes roughly 9% lower unit cost. Pilot orders of 2,000 units each are planned for next quarter, with a qualification decision expected by the January board meeting. Procurement will circulate the full audit comparison ahead of that discussion.

board note of fahag-tajop: The eastern region missed its Julix quota by 44.0 percent last quarter. Ralionax Holdings plans to lower the Druath list price by 61.8 percent in March. The board signed off on a budget of $295.0 million for Project Gilath. The renewal with Ruswynix Systems closes at $274.5 million a year, 17.0 percent above the last contract.

**Vendor note: Inkmill markdown pipeline**

Rendering for Parchway docs is outsourced to Inkmill under an annual contract, renewing each March. They handle sanitization and PDF export; we own the upload queue. SLA: 4-hour response on rendering failures. Escalate only after two failed retries. Their support desk is reachable at the address below.

billing contact of hahaf-baguf = zorael.tammir.jorius@sivrelhq.internal

Handover — key-card stock, Larkspur Annex. Taking over from Dovra's shift. Forty blanks arrived from Prentix Systems; twelve are pre-encoded for the new site, kept in the grey lockbox behind the dispatch counter. Do not mix with Halmere stock. Encoder is booked out until Thursday. Courier collects the pre-encoded set tomorrow morning; the hand-over instruction for the courier is as follows.

courier memo of tawep-tajep: the quenius ulaiel courier leaves the fenir ledger at gate 9128 under passcode 527513

Handover note — Crumbwheel order cutoffs.

Welcome aboard. The bakery cutoff rule in Crumbwheel closes same-day orders at 14:00 local to each storefront, not UTC — this has bitten us twice. Holiday overrides live in the calendar service and take precedence silently, so always check there first when a cutoff looks wrong. To unlock the calendar service's admin console after a restart, enter the recovery passphrase below.

vault phrase of bagap-bahaf = silion-pelox-sorox-casdor-quenwyn-fraax-eliox-praael-kelion-quenvan-kasox-rusael-norius-belvan